A new popular-science book on the landscape evolution of the Křivoklátsko Protected Landscape Area

Two staff members of the Institute of Geology AS CR, Karel Žák and Václav Cílek, became authors of a new book on the landscape evolution of this nature-protected area. The book reviews landscape evolution since the oldest geological past until the present time (Křivoklátsko – The Story of the Royal Hunting Forest by K. Žák, M. Majer, P. Hůla, V. Cílek). The book was published with the financial support of the Central Bohemian Region in the Dokořán publishing house. Toxic metals revealed to be absorbed by mycorrhizal fungi at plant roots

Jan Borovička and his co-workers have published a study on the accumulation of toxic metals and other elements in ectomycorrhizal roots of Norway spruce (Environmental Pollution, Impact Factor: 4.839). Their research was conducted in the Příbram area, subjected to long-lasting man-induced pollution from ore mining and processing. When compared to non-mycorrhizal tiny spruce roots and organic soils, concentrations of metals (cadmium and silver in particular) were significantly elevated in ectomycorrhizal roots. This phenomenon can be attributed to metal-binding capacity of fungal mycelia. These results support the hypothesis that mycorrhizal fungi may protect host plants against heavy metal toxicity in polluted environments.

Microbial precipitates in old iron ore mines (central Bohemia)

One of the preserved galleries in the former iron-ore mining district of Zdice (35 km SW of Prague) originated between 1950 and 1965. The iron-rich layer, Ordovician (460 million years) in age, was found to be of low thickness and low grade to be economic. The present study of the gallery is focused on presently forming secondary precipitates of iron and calcium compounds. A geological-speleological expedition in China

In early June, a geological-speleological expedition participated by Michal Filippi returned from China. This joint expedition of the Czech Speleological Society (Z. Motyčka, L. Matuška, R. Šebela), Institute of Geology of the Czech Academy of Sciences (M.F.) and the Institute of Karst Geology of the Chinese Academy of Sciences (Zhang Yuan Hai) examined and evaluated the potential for geological and speleological research in unexplored areas close to Xiaonanhai, Zhenba, and Sanyuan cities in Shaanxi Province, central China. The expedition resulted, among others, in the discovery of several new remarkable caves. Of special value was the extension of co-operation with workers of the Institute of Karst Geology and emerging co-operation with geologists of the Chinese Geological Survey.
